Importing PST contacts into an iPhone can be complicated because iOS does not support PST files natively. Outlook users who want to access their contacts on an iPhone need a reliable method that maintains data accuracy and avoids manual errors. One of the top and most effective methods is to convert PST contacts into vCard (VCF) format, which is fully compatible with iPhone and iCloud.
